summaryrefslogtreecommitdiffstats
path: root/meta-poky/conf/distro/poky.conf
diff options
context:
space:
mode:
Diffstat (limited to 'meta-poky/conf/distro/poky.conf')
-rw-r--r--meta-poky/conf/distro/poky.conf54
1 files changed, 28 insertions, 26 deletions
diff --git a/meta-poky/conf/distro/poky.conf b/meta-poky/conf/distro/poky.conf
index 16b3bed1e8..5285753c31 100644
--- a/meta-poky/conf/distro/poky.conf
+++ b/meta-poky/conf/distro/poky.conf
@@ -1,26 +1,26 @@
DISTRO = "poky"
DISTRO_NAME = "Poky (Yocto Project Reference Distro)"
-DISTRO_VERSION = "3.4"
-DISTRO_CODENAME = "honister"
+DISTRO_VERSION = "5.0+snapshot-${METADATA_REVISION}"
+DISTRO_CODENAME = "styhead"
SDK_VENDOR = "-pokysdk"
SDK_VERSION = "${@d.getVar('DISTRO_VERSION').replace('snapshot-${METADATA_REVISION}', 'snapshot')}"
SDK_VERSION[vardepvalue] = "${SDK_VERSION}"
-MAINTAINER = "Poky <poky@lists.yoctoproject.org>"
+MAINTAINER = "Poky Maintainers <poky@lists.yoctoproject.org>"
TARGET_VENDOR = "-poky"
LOCALCONF_VERSION = "2"
# Override these in poky based distros
-POKY_DEFAULT_DISTRO_FEATURES = "largefile opengl ptest multiarch wayland vulkan"
+POKY_DEFAULT_DISTRO_FEATURES = "opengl ptest multiarch wayland vulkan"
POKY_DEFAULT_EXTRA_RDEPENDS = "packagegroup-core-boot"
POKY_DEFAULT_EXTRA_RRECOMMENDS = "kernel-module-af-packet"
DISTRO_FEATURES ?= "${DISTRO_FEATURES_DEFAULT} ${POKY_DEFAULT_DISTRO_FEATURES}"
-PREFERRED_VERSION_linux-yocto ?= "5.14%"
-PREFERRED_VERSION_linux-yocto-rt ?= "5.14%"
+PREFERRED_VERSION_linux-yocto ?= "6.6%"
+PREFERRED_VERSION_linux-yocto-rt ?= "6.6%"
SDK_NAME = "${DISTRO}-${TCLIBC}-${SDKMACHINE}-${IMAGE_BASENAME}-${TUNE_PKGARCH}-${MACHINE}"
SDKPATHINSTALL = "/opt/${DISTRO}/${SDK_VERSION}"
@@ -30,30 +30,23 @@ DISTRO_EXTRA_RRECOMMENDS += "${POKY_DEFAULT_EXTRA_RRECOMMENDS}"
TCLIBCAPPEND = ""
-PREMIRRORS ??= "\
-bzr://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-cvs://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-git://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-gitsm://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-hg://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-osc://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-p4://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n \
-svn://.*/.* https://downloads.yoctoproject.org/mirror/sources/ \n"
+PACKAGE_CLASSES ?= "package_rpm"
SANITY_TESTED_DISTROS ?= " \
- poky-3.3 \n \
- poky-3.4 \n \
- ubuntu-16.04 \n \
- ubuntu-18.04 \n \
+ poky-4.3 \n \
+ poky-5.0 \n \
ubuntu-20.04 \n \
- fedora-33 \n \
- fedora-34 \n \
- centos-7 \n \
- centos-8 \n \
- debian-9 \n \
- debian-10 \n \
+ ubuntu-22.04 \n \
+ ubuntu-23.04 \n \
+ fedora-38 \n \
+ fedora-39 \n \
+ centosstream-8 \n \
debian-11 \n \
- opensuseleap-15.2 \n \
+ debian-12 \n \
+ opensuseleap-15.4 \n \
+ almalinux-8.8 \n \
+ almalinux-9.2 \n \
+ rocky-9 \n \
"
# add poky sanity bbclass
INHERIT += "poky-sanity"
@@ -72,3 +65,12 @@ INHERIT += "uninative"
BB_SIGNATURE_HANDLER ?= "OEEquivHash"
BB_HASHSERVE ??= "auto"
+
+POKY_INIT_MANAGER = "sysvinit"
+INIT_MANAGER ?= "${POKY_INIT_MANAGER}"
+
+# We need debug symbols so that SPDX license manifests for the kernel work
+KERNEL_EXTRA_FEATURES:append = " features/debug/debug-kernel.scc"
+
+# Enable creation of SPDX manifests by default
+INHERIT += "create-spdx"